On February 14, 1940 Earl married Ocie D.Stotler in Paden, Oklahoma. He worked as an auto mechanic at the Broadway Garage in Seminole for many years. Earl was a member of the New Life Assembly of God in Shawnee, Oklahoma.
Earl is survived by his wife, Ocie of the home; two sons, Jimmie Jackson of McLoud, Oklahoma and Ronnie Jackson of Shawnee, Oklahoma; one daughter, Peggie Goforth of Seminole, Oklahoma; 9 grandchildren, 15 great-grandchildren and 3 great-great-grandchildren as well as other family and friends.
He is preceded in death by his parents, three brothers, one sister, one niece and one grandson.
Graveside services are scheduled for 2:00 p.m., Monday, April 2, 2012 at Little Cemetery north of Seminole with
David Pollard officiating.
Services are under the direction of Swearingen Funeral Home in Seminole.
